Delaware’s leading nonprofit, private agency serving the autism community statewide seeks an individual who is fluent in both English and Spanish and who is the parent or caregiver of a loved one with autism spectrum disorder. As such, they can bring their lived experience to bear in providing one-on-one support and education to both Spanish- and English-speaking families of children with autism. The Family Support Provider (FSP) must have leadership and partnership skills that can teach families how to get the support they need from the complex system of services that can make the day-to-day work of a parent of a child or youth with autism spectrum disorder extremely challenging, especially for those who face language barriers.
FSPs help families navigate educational, therapeutic, and social services systems, coach families on developing advocacy skills and making informed decisions, serve as an emotional support and positive role model to parents and caregivers, and work with families to solve problems related to the care of their child or youth. These tasks require scheduling regular meetings with their assigned families and maintaining documentation of services through an electronic database. Knowledge of Delaware service systems and the range of resources available is essential. The employee must be able to share that knowledge effectively during family meetings and consultation with professionals.
